How much does it cost to rent a home in Jacksonville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jacksonville 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,619 | $639 | $10,000+ |
Jacksonville 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,972 | $600 | $10,000+ |
Jacksonville 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,534 | $825 | $10,000+ |
Jacksonville 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,120 | $647 | $10,000+ |
Jacksonville 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,592 | $2,800 | $10,000+ |
Jacksonville 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$13,216 | $650 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Jacksonville
What type of rentals are currently available in Jacksonville?
There are currently 1804 Apartments for Rent in Jacksonville, FL with pricing that ranges from $582 to $19,029. There are also 3399 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Jacksonville ranging from $500 to $25,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Jacksonville?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Jacksonville ranges from $500 to $25,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,032.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Jacksonville?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Jacksonville range from $750 to $14,002,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$600 to $14,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$825 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$837.
